Pros

Everyone is very passionate about the work and people get really excited during projects. The team is really valued and collaboration is encouraged. Everyone is super smart and talented, so you are surrounded by people that will challenge you. But, everyone is super friendly, so you will learn a ton. They play music in the office, always have fresh healthy snacks, and the office is on Miracle Mile, so there are hundreds of restaurants and shops to check out. BIG PLUS +

Cons

Even with cases of redbull and loads of Nespresso, there is never enough caffeine in the office. You may have to come in costume on some Fedora Fridays, as the creative team has been known to instate an 80's day or a superhero day from time to time.

Pros

- Extremely supportive team with good energy. People come in excited for their day, happy to see you, and ready to help each other. - Very involved and caring leadership. I have learned and grown so much as a direct result of the hands on mentorship and support of senior team. They want to see you grow and are ready to elevate you when you put in the work. - Diverse client portfolio. You'll get to do work in multiple industries and never have to worry about doing the same thing every day. - Location is a HUGE plus here, walking distance from great cafes, restaurants and bars - The office itself is a beautiful space. It has great lighting, modern decor, is spacious, and has a balcony.

Cons

- It is a fast paced environment. You need to be quick on your toes to adapt to changing priorities. If you prefer doing the same tasks everyday this might not be for you. - Even though it is a lot of fun, it is serious work and you need to come in ready to roll up your sleeves and be mentally on your game. Not necessarily a con because it is extremely rewarding and your efforts are recognized, but it is not for the faint of heart.
